22 July 2024

22 July 2024
Notes for weekly communication of ongoing projects and modules.

Announcements

Modules & Projects

Google Summer of Code - Midterm

The midterm evaluations have been submitted end of last week and all six contributors passed. Congratulations! Here a short overview of what has been done already by the contributors:

Meeting Notes

New Features and Changes

This is a selection of changes that happened over the last week. For a full overview including fixes, code only changes and more visit projects.blender.org.

Anim

  • Deselect Keys before inserting new keys (commit) - (Christoph Lendenfeld)

Curves

  • Store active attribute index on curves geometry (commit) - (Jacques Lucke)

EEVEE

  • Improve Pixel Size Upscaling (commit) - (ClĂ©ment Foucault)

GPv3

  • Edit mode overlay curve lines and bĂ©zier handles. (commit) - (casey bianco-davis)
  • Render evaluated geometry (commit) - (Casey Bianco-Davis)

Geometry Nodes

  • Support simulating and baking grease pencil geometry (commit) - (Jacques Lucke)
  • Add conversion nodes for Grease Pencil and Curves (commit) - (Jacques Lucke)

Image Plane

  • Add support for EEVEE (commit) - (Jeroen Bakker)

Overlay-Next

  • Lattice (commit) - (Laurynas Duburas)

Sculpt

  • Data oriented refactor for enhance details brush (commit) - (Hans Goudey)
  • Simplify gathering of position data (commit) - (Hans Goudey)
  • Data oriented refactor for “Set Pivot Position” operator (commit) - (Hans Goudey)

Sound

  • Add channels and sample rate properties to mixdown operator (commit) - (Matthieu Carteron)

UI

  • Remove unused brush tool icons (commit) - (Julian Eisel)
  • Allow Use of Full-Color UI Icons (commit) - (Harley Acheson)
  • Screen Area Docking Experimental Feature (commit) - (Harley Acheson)
  • Icon Hover Brightness for Properties Items (commit) - (Harley Acheson)
  • Remove “Widget Label” Text Style (commit) - (Harley Acheson)
  • Don’t Dim Docking Remainders (commit) - (Harley Acheson)

VSE

  • Reword the text of the movie add “use_framerate” option (commit) - (Sebastian Parborg)

Weekly Reports

Google Summer of Code - Week 8

6 Likes